ENGINE COOLANT HOT/ENGINE
OVERHEATED

Notice: If you drive your vehicle while the
engine is overheating, severe engine damage
may occur. If an overheat warning appears on
the instrument panel cluster and/or DIC, stop
the vehicle as soon as possible. Do not increase
the engine speed above normal idling speed.
See Engine Overheating
on page 408 for more
information.

This message displays and a chime sounds if the
cooling system temperature gets hot. See
Engine Overheating on page 408 for the proper
course of action. This message clears when
the coolant temperature drops to a safe operating
temperature.

FUEL LEVEL LOW

This message displays and a chime sounds if the
fuel level is low in the vehicle’s fuel tank. Refuel as
soon as possible. Press any of the DIC buttons, or
the trip stem, to acknowledge this message and
clear it from the DIC display. See Low Fuel Warning
Light
on page 217, Filling the Tank on page 385,
and Fuel on page 382 for more information.

ICE POSSIBLE

This message may display if the outside
temperature reaches a level where ice could form
on the roadway. If the temperature rises to a safe
level, the message clears. This message clears
itself after 10 seconds, or you can press any of the
DIC buttons, or the trip stem, to acknowledge this
message and clear it from the DIC display.

KEY FOB # BATTERY LOW

This message displays if a Remote Keyless Entry
(RKE) transmitter battery is low. Replace the
battery in the transmitter. See “Battery
Replacement” under Remote Keyless Entry (RKE)
System Operation
on page 98. Press any of the
DIC buttons, or the trip stem, to acknowledge this
message and clear it from the DIC display.

LEFT REAR DOOR AJAR

This message displays and a chime sounds if the
driver’s side rear door is not fully closed. Stop and
turn off the vehicle, check the door for obstructions,
and close the door again. Check to see if the
message still appears on the DIC. Press any of the
DIC buttons, or the trip stem, to acknowledge this
message and clear it from the DIC display.
